京準(zhǔn)電鐘|基于納秒級的GPS北斗衛(wèi)星授時服務(wù)器
你有沒有思考過這樣一個問題:火車站內(nèi),熙熙攘攘,旅客排隊進(jìn)站、列車??堪l(fā)車,一切井然有序。一旦有個別時間出現(xiàn)錯誤,便會造成運(yùn)行混亂——這些時鐘如何能做到精準(zhǔn)統(tǒng)一、不差分毫?
答案便是車站里的“時間管理大師”——時間同步系統(tǒng)。這是一種能接收外部衛(wèi)星時間基準(zhǔn)信號,并按照要求的時間精度向外輸出時間同步信號和時間信息的系統(tǒng),通俗來講,它能使網(wǎng)絡(luò)內(nèi)的所有設(shè)備時鐘對準(zhǔn)并同步一致。
它的應(yīng)用場景也十分廣泛,金融、電力、交通、醫(yī)療等各行各業(yè)平穩(wěn)運(yùn)行,都離不開它的精準(zhǔn)同步。然而這個保障國家重要領(lǐng)域安全運(yùn)行的技術(shù),曾長期被國外壟斷。
“時間”必須掌握在中國人自己手里
京準(zhǔn)電子對時間同步行業(yè)的發(fā)展有著清醒的認(rèn)識,我們明白只有經(jīng)過不懈的努力,使我國時間同步的質(zhì)量和水平并身國際先進(jìn)行列。但在高端細(xì)分領(lǐng)域尤其是電子信息技術(shù)主導(dǎo)的技術(shù)用鐘領(lǐng)域,仍嚴(yán)重落后于國外同行。金融、電力、核電等重要領(lǐng)域的授時系統(tǒng)仍被國外品牌所壟斷,從經(jīng)濟(jì)運(yùn)行、國家安全角度講,存在一定“隱患”?!皳Q句話說,我們沒有自己的‘時間’,這是很被動的事情?!弊源?,“一定要把‘時間’牢牢掌握在中國人自己手里!”就萌生在安徽京準(zhǔn)人的心里。
懷揣著讓時間同步領(lǐng)先世界的夢想和追求,開啟了我們的創(chuàng)業(yè)之路。在國外技術(shù)封鎖、無經(jīng)驗可借鑒的情況下,團(tuán)隊經(jīng)歷了無數(shù)次失敗,歷時5年多,終于研發(fā)出具有自主知識產(chǎn)權(quán)的“時間同步系統(tǒng)”。后來,京準(zhǔn)時鐘成功助力港珠澳大橋、葛洲壩、都江堰、中石油、中石化、北京市公安局等國家重點(diǎn)項目時鐘同步工作,打破了國外壟斷。
時間同步系統(tǒng)的研發(fā)難度,主要體現(xiàn)在精確性和同步性兩方面。“時間信號在傳遞過程中會有丟失和延遲?!睘榱俗畲蟪潭壬舷@種誤差,技術(shù)團(tuán)隊發(fā)明了一種時間推后補(bǔ)償?shù)募夹g(shù),通過核心算法,能夠?qū)⒄`差控制在納秒級別,比行業(yè)標(biāo)準(zhǔn)高出1000倍,達(dá)到了國內(nèi)領(lǐng)先、國際一流水平。
網(wǎng)絡(luò)時間同步協(xié)議NTP協(xié)議屬于應(yīng)用層協(xié)議,是用于在分布式時間服務(wù)器和客戶端之間進(jìn)行時間同步的,它定義了協(xié)議實(shí)現(xiàn)過程中所使用的結(jié)構(gòu)、算法、實(shí)體和協(xié)議。NTP協(xié)議是基于IP和UDP的,也可以被其它協(xié)議組使用。NTP是從時間協(xié)議(TIME PROTOCOL)和ICMP 時間戳報文(ICMP TIMESTAMP MESSAGE)演變而來,主要是從準(zhǔn)確性和強(qiáng)壯性方面進(jìn)行了特殊的設(shè)計。
NTP的優(yōu)點(diǎn):
è 采用分層的方法來定義時鐘的準(zhǔn)確性,可以迅速同步網(wǎng)絡(luò)中各臺設(shè)備的時間。
è 支持訪問控制和MD5驗證。
è 可以選擇采用單播、廣播或組播發(fā)送協(xié)議報文。
IEEE1588(PTP)協(xié)議借鑒了NTP技術(shù),具有容易配置、快速收斂以及對網(wǎng)絡(luò)帶寬和資源消耗少等特點(diǎn)。IEEE1588標(biāo)準(zhǔn)的全稱是“網(wǎng)絡(luò)測量和控制系統(tǒng)的精密時鐘同步協(xié)議標(biāo)準(zhǔn)(IEEE 1588 Precision Clock Synchronization Protocol)”,簡稱PTP(Precision Timing Protocol),它的主要原理是通過一個同步信號周期性的對網(wǎng)絡(luò)中所有節(jié)點(diǎn)的時鐘進(jìn)行校正同步,可以使基于以太網(wǎng)的分布式系統(tǒng)達(dá)到精確同步,IEEE 1588PTP時鐘同步技術(shù)也可以應(yīng)用于任何組播網(wǎng)絡(luò)中。
IEEE1588將整個網(wǎng)絡(luò)內(nèi)的時鐘分為兩種,即普通時鐘(Ordinary Clock,OC)和邊界時鐘(Boundary Clock,BC),只有一個PTP通信端口的時鐘是普通時鐘,有一個以上PTP通信端口的時鐘是邊界時鐘,每個PTP端口提供獨(dú)立的PTP通信。其中,邊界時鐘通常用在確定性較差的網(wǎng)絡(luò)設(shè)備(如交換機(jī)和路由器)上。從通信關(guān)系上又可把時鐘分為主時鐘和從時鐘,理論上任何時鐘都能實(shí)現(xiàn)主時鐘和從時鐘的功能,但一個PTP通信子網(wǎng)內(nèi)只能有一個主時鐘。整個系統(tǒng)中的最優(yōu)時鐘為最高級時鐘GMC(Grandmaster Clock),有著最好的穩(wěn)定性、精確性、確定性等。根據(jù)各節(jié)點(diǎn)上時鐘的精度和級別以及UTC(通用協(xié)調(diào)時間)的可追溯性等特性,由最佳主時鐘算法(Best Master Clock)來自動選擇各子網(wǎng)內(nèi)的主時鐘;在只有一個子網(wǎng)的系統(tǒng)中,主時鐘就是最高級時鐘GMC。每個系統(tǒng)只有一個GMC,且每個子網(wǎng)內(nèi)只有一個主時鐘,從時鐘與主時鐘保持同步;
無論從NTP還是PTP協(xié)議入手,都是希望建立起系統(tǒng)時間同步網(wǎng)絡(luò)的精準(zhǔn)度,并將時間同步的服務(wù)端和客戶端封裝為獨(dú)立的類庫,以實(shí)現(xiàn)與各種現(xiàn)有系統(tǒng)的裝配。與現(xiàn)有系統(tǒng)進(jìn)行集成裝配的應(yīng)用表明,基于NTP的時間同步網(wǎng)絡(luò)負(fù)載較小,是網(wǎng)絡(luò)系統(tǒng)中實(shí)現(xiàn)時間同步的有效辦法。PTP依靠它自身強(qiáng)大的精度實(shí)現(xiàn)更高速的精準(zhǔn)同步,使整個系統(tǒng)進(jìn)行校時的辦法。不管哪一種同步方式,目的只有一個就是讓網(wǎng)絡(luò)系統(tǒng)時鐘更精準(zhǔn)、更可靠,更穩(wěn)定。
審核編輯 黃宇
-
gps
+關(guān)注
關(guān)注
22文章
2986瀏覽量
169324 -
服務(wù)器
+關(guān)注
關(guān)注
13文章
9793瀏覽量
87933
發(fā)布評論請先 登錄
京準(zhǔn)電鐘守護(hù)時鐘防線:北斗網(wǎng)絡(luò)授時服務(wù)器構(gòu)建安全堡壘

京準(zhǔn)電鐘:關(guān)于北斗授時服務(wù)器技術(shù)應(yīng)用方案
京準(zhǔn)電鐘:GPS北斗衛(wèi)星校時服務(wù)器助力區(qū)塊鏈數(shù)據(jù)網(wǎng)

GPS北斗衛(wèi)星授時:雙系統(tǒng)NTP網(wǎng)絡(luò)時間服務(wù)器

安徽京準(zhǔn):北斗衛(wèi)星授時服務(wù)器 NTP服務(wù)器 助力智慧城市建設(shè)

評論